Ans 1 :
The heat lost by metal will be gained by water.
Let the final temperature be T
heat = m . c . delta T
32.5 x 0.902 x (67.4 - T) = 58.2 x 4.18 x (T - 21.2)
67.4 - T = 8.29 (T - 21.2)
67.4 - T = 8.29 T - 175.9
67.4 + 175.9 = 8.29 T + T
9.29 T = 243.3
T = 26.19 oC
